The Calculus of Context-aware Ambients (CCA in short)
has been proposed as a notation that is suitable to model
mobile applications that are context-aware. This paper
considers a real-world case study of an infostation-based
mLearning system in which mobile devices such as hand-set
phones, PDA’s and laptops can access a number of services
and communicate to each other within a university campus.
Such a dynamic system must enforce complex policies
to cope with mobility and context-awareness. We show
how policies can be formalised using CCA, and validated
using the execution environment of CCA. We illustrate how
properties can be validated using our approach. |
